Liberation analysis was carried out by particle size analysis and specific gravity measurement. Chemical analysis results showed that, -125+90? size fraction assaying up to 57.34% Fe, 8.55% SiO 2 and 8.6% Al 2 O 3 . XRD analysis revealed the presence of major hematite phase along with kaolinite, gibbsite, quartz and goethite in the sample. Microscopic study confirms the transformation of magnetite to hematite by martitization.
